This is, by far, the best phone I've ever had. Yes the GSIII is out and it has better features. But my Nexus is still competing with phones that are barely coming out. The recent Jelly Bean update is nothing to this beast, it runs buttery smooth. There are two things that I would change however, the speaker isn't loud enough and when I'm playing games, I sometimes cover it with my fingers. And the camera could have also had higher MP's. Otherwise, this is a great phone.

The Galaxy Nexus is a very complete, fast and beautiful phone. With the new Jelly Bean upgrade smooth just runs even smoother. The beautiful 4.65" screen is big enough for everything, but not too big. The response of the phone is instant, along with the almost 0 shutter speed of the camera this phone all around is excellent and well rounded. The only con I have about the phone is the fact it does not have a Micro SD card slot, other than that it is excellent.
